Remember a day when Chardonnay used to be that really full oak overwhelming experience? So cringeworthy. Those 80’s Chardonnay’s made a really bad name for themselves. It was only really in the last 6 years or so I became aware of a thing called a “new-wave” Chardonnay, which was infinitely more pleasant to drink. I was a little worried this Lindeman’s drop would rely on that oak profile, but I needn’t have!
Such a pleasant surprise in a glass! This Semillon Chardonnay is robust and full of flavour. I don’t get that “dissolved ice cube” vibe I have had from other still white wines.
The flavour profile is fruity, acidic and not too sweet. I would bear in mind that your dedicated reviewer does have quite a high tolerance for acidic profiles, so if you’re a bit averse in that department, approach with caution.
An overall great experience, nice to find a still white with some body to it!
Rating: 8/10
